摘要
为提高多路ARINC429总线数据接收和发送的实时性,提出一种基于POWERPC硬件和嵌入式实时VxWorks操作系统的ARINC429总线接口解决方案,将ARINC429协议芯片映射到地址空间,简化了传统驱动开发中设备向I/O系统注册和创建的过程,利用VxWorks实时操作系统的多任务特点,实现多通道ARINC429通讯并行处理,有效提高了系统的实时处理能力;通过在直升机完好性与使用监测系统中应用表明,该解决方案实时性好、可靠性高,满足系统要求,具有很好的推广应用前景。
To improve the real--time communication of multi--channels ARINC429 bus acquisitions and transmissions, a kind of new ARINC429 interface card based on POWERPC and the embedded VxWorks real--time operating system is put forward. Mapping ARINC429 bus protocol chips to the memory address space, it simplifies traditional development of driver. Making full use of the VxWorks which is the real--time multi--task operating system, multi --channels ARINC429 bus acquisitions and transmissions are accomplished. Its processing rate is higher, it can improve the performance of this 429 interface card. This system can successfully run in practical application, with good promotion prospects.
出处
《计算机测量与控制》
北大核心
2013年第3期719-721,共3页
Computer Measurement &Control